DPH warns public not to drink bottled water from Mass. company due to PFAS contamination

The Department of Public Health is warning the public not to drink bottled water from a Massachusetts company due to PFAS contamination. St. Croix tap water remains unsafe to drink as US Virgin Islands offer short-term solutions

SAN JUAN, Puerto Rico — With no date in sight for when it will be safe to drink tap water again on the island of St. Croix, officials in the U.S. Virgin Islands announced Wednesday night that they would distribute water filters and provide free lead and copper testing as they work on long-term solutions. … Read more

A boozy banana drink in Uganda is under threat as authorities move to restrict home brewers

MBARARA, Uganda (AP) — At least once a week, Girino Ndyanabo’s family converges around a pit in which bananas have been left to ripen.
